An Ontology Mapping Algorithm between Heterogeneous Product Classification Taxonomies

چکیده

Research on ontology merging and mapping is one of the most important issues in the Semantic Web because ontologies are developed and used by various sites and organizations respectively. Electronic commerce is the area that require ontology mapping on product comparison over different product classification taxonomies of various shopping malls. But, a strict mapping strategy may lead a customer’s configuration to search failure. Therefore we suggest a mapping algorithm for product matching that can provide more products by increasing sensitivity with reasonable decrease of specificity. We performed a comparative evaluation between our algorithm and PROMPT with 6 experimental sets.
